                        <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>@Boo you are fine at 52 bridge, 50mm spring space neck pick up and 43mm nut. For 22 frets, end of your fretboard at 56mm is plenty room. I built a parlor 3/4 scale six string cigar box with those specs and it was perfectly fine.</p>]]></content:encoded>
